How the World Cup is showing a different side of the US | FT #shorts

So far, this has been an unexpectedly good World Cup, writes Simon Kuper.⁠

It’s partly the profusion of goals — unmatched since the 1950s — and partly the abundance of minnows, each with its own Cinderella story, some of them doing surprisingly well.⁠

But the tournament’s biggest asset may be, against all expectations, the US.⁠
